πŸ“ Match Preview

Adelaide vs City: Defensive Battle Expected
Recommendation:UNDER_2_5
Odds:2.20
Expected Value:+21.0%

This Friday morning clash presents a fascinating tactical puzzle between two teams heading in different directions. Adelaide United arrive with a formidable home record - they've won their last three matches at home, scoring 2.33 goals per game while keeping things relatively tight at the back with just one goal conceded per home fixture. However, their overall form tells a different story, with just 3 wins from their last 10 outings and a concerning 80% both teams to score rate. Melbourne City, meanwhile, have been the model of consistency on their travels. Their away defensive record is particularly impressive, conceding just 0.83 goals per game while keeping clean sheets in 40% of their matches overall. Recent results show their quality too - a 2-0 victory over Melbourne Victory and a solid 2-1 win against Machida Zelvia in AFC Champions League action demonstrate their ability to grind out results. The head-to-head history heavily favors Adelaide at home, where they've won 75% of their encounters against City. However, the last meeting ended 0-0, and recent H2H matches have trended towards lower scoring affairs. Statistically, this shapes up as a defensive battle. Adelaide might dominate possession and shots (they average 13.75 shots per game with 59.9% accuracy at home), but City's away defensive structure has proven difficult to break down. City average just 9.50 shots away but maintain excellent defensive discipline. The key factor here is the clash of styles - Adelaide's home attacking firepower (2.33 goals per home game) versus City's away defensive resilience (0.83 goals conceded per away game). With City scoring just 0.83 goals per away game and Adelaide conceding only 1.0 at home, we're likely looking at a tight, low-scoring contest where defensive organization trumps attacking flair. Key Points: β€’ Adelaide boast a perfect 100% home record in their last 3 matches β€’ Melbourne City have conceded just 0.83 goals per away game this season β€’ Head-to-head favors Adelaide at home with a 75% win rate β€’ Recent H2H matches show a trend towards low scoring (last 3 meetings: 0-0, 1-0, 0-1) β€’ City have kept 40% clean sheets compared to Adelaide's 20% β€’ Both teams have similar rest periods (14 vs 13 days) Given City's defensive solidity on the road and the recent low-scoring trend in this fixture, the value lies with goals staying under the total. Adelaide's home attacking prowess is countered by City's excellent away defensive record, creating the perfect scenario for a tight, tactical battle where chances will be at a premium.
